ASME SA573 Grade 58 Steel Plate Introduction
ASME SA573 Grade 58 is a carbon-silicon structural steel plate intended for riveted, bolted, or welded construction of bridges, buildings, and other structures. With a specified minimum tensile strength of 58 ksi (400 MPa) and good notch toughness, it offers a balance of strength, weldability, and formability. This material is typically supplied in the as-rolled or normalized condition and is well-suited for moderate-temperature service and general fabrication.
ASME SA573 Grade 58 Steel Plate Chemical Composition
Typical ladle analysis limits according to ASME SA573/SA573M for Grade 58, thickness ≤ 40 mm. For other thicknesses or special requirements, refer to the standard.
| Element | Standard Value | Remarks |
|---|---|---|
| Carbon (C) | ≤ 0.23 | Maximum; for thickness >40 mm, max 0.25% |
| Manganese (Mn) | 0.60 – 0.90 | For Grade 58 |
| Phosphorus (P) | ≤ 0.035 | Maximum |
| Sulfur (S) | ≤ 0.04 | Maximum |
| Silicon (Si) | 0.15 – 0.40 | Range for silicon-killed; may be 0.15–0.30% for other deoxidation practices |
| Copper (Cu) | ≥ 0.20 | Minimum when copper steel is specified (optional) |
ASME SA573 Grade 58 Steel Plate Thermal and Electrical Physical Properties
Typical physical properties for carbon steel plates are listed. These values are not specific to SA573 Grade 58 but are representative of structural carbon steels with similar composition and are useful for design.
| Property | Typical Value | Unit | Test Condition / Remarks |
|---|---|---|---|
| Density (ρ) | 7.85 | g/cm³ | At room temperature |
| Elastic Modulus (E) | 200 | GPa | At room temperature |
| Shear Modulus (G) | 77 | GPa | Estimated (E/(2(1+ν))) |
| Poisson's Ratio (ν) | 0.30 | – | Typical for steel |
| Thermal Expansion Coefficient (α) | 12.0 | 10⁻⁶/K | 20–100°C |
| Thermal Expansion Coefficient (α) | 12.5 | 10⁻⁶/K | 20–200°C |
| Thermal Expansion Coefficient (α) | 13.0 | 10⁻⁶/K | 20–300°C |
| Thermal Conductivity (λ) | 52 | W/(m·K) | At 20°C |
| Specific Heat Capacity | 460 | J/(kg·K) | At 20°C |
| Electrical Resistivity (ρₑ) | 0.15 | μΩ·m | At room temperature |
ASME SA573 Grade 58 Steel Plate Mechanical Properties
Tensile requirements according to ASME SA573/SA573M for Grade 58 plates.
- Yield strength values are minimum for the specified thickness.
- Elongation in 200 mm (8 in.) for plate thickness ≤ 20 mm; for other thicknesses, a 50 mm (2 in.) gauge length or proportional specimen is used.
| Property | Standard Value | Unit | Test Condition |
|---|---|---|---|
| Tensile Strength (Rm) | 58 – 71 | ksi | For all thicknesses |
| Tensile Strength (Rm) | 400 – 490 | MPa | For all thicknesses |
| Yield Strength (ReH), minimum | 32 | ksi | Thickness ≤ 20 mm |
| Yield Strength (ReH), minimum | 220 | MPa | Thickness ≤ 20 mm |
| Yield Strength (ReH), minimum | 29 | ksi | Thickness >20 mm to 40 mm |
| Yield Strength (ReH), minimum | 200 | MPa | Thickness >20 mm to 40 mm |
| Elongation (A) in 200 mm, minimum | 21 | % | Thickness ≤ 20 mm |
| Elongation (A) in 50 mm, minimum | 24 | % | Thickness >20 mm to 40 mm |
| Bend Test (bend diameter) | 1½ × thickness | – | 180° bend, cold; thickness ≤ 25 mm |
| Bend Test (bend diameter) | 2 × thickness | – | 180° bend, cold; thickness >25 mm to 40 mm |

ASME SA573 Grade 58 Steel Plate Application Introduction
ASME SA573 Grade 58 plates are widely used in structural engineering due to their reliable mechanical properties and good weldability. The material can be readily cut, drilled, machined, and formed using conventional methods.
Product Applications: Structural frameworks, columns, and beams, Bridge decks and girders, Pressure vessel shells (within design limits), Storage tank bottoms and roofs, Railcar side frames and bolsters, Welded tubular structures, Material handling equipment
Processed into products: Gusset plates, splice plates, and connection angles, Base plates and stiffeners, Fabricated box sections and truss members, Pipe supports and hangers, Machine bases and frames, Earthmoving equipment buckets and blades
Application industries: Bridge construction and repair, Commercial and industrial buildings, Railway rolling stock and automotive components, Storage tanks and silos (non-pressure or low-pressure), Transmission towers and telecommunication masts, Shipbuilding (non-classified structural parts), Machinery manufacturing and heavy equipment
ASME SA573 Grade 58 Steel Plate Similar and Alternative Material Recommendations
| Country/Region | Standard | Grade | Remarks |
|---|---|---|---|
| Europe | EN 10025-2 | S275J0 (1.0143) / S275J2 (1.0145) | Similar tensile strength (410–560 MPa) and yield (~275 MPa). Verify impact toughness and weldability requirements. |
| Japan | JIS G3106 | SM400B / SM400C | Tensile class 400–510 MPa; similar structural use. Impact properties depend on subgrade. |
| China | GB/T 700 | Q235B / Q235C | Similar tensile strength range (375–500 MPa), but lower specified yield (235 MPa). Check toughness. |
| India | IS 2062 | E250 (Fe 410W) B / C | Comparable yield and tensile strength for general structural applications. |
| Russia | GOST 380 / GOST 535 | St3sp / St3ps | Close in carbon-manganese composition and strength; impact test options differ. |
Notes:
- When impact testing is required, refer to supplementary requirements S5 of ASTM A6/A6M. Charpy V-notch values should be specified by the purchaser.
- Flange-quality steel for concentrated load conditions is not covered; use only as specified in ASME SA573/SA573M.
- Welding should comply with the applicable structural welding code (AWS D1.1 or ASME Section IX). Preheating and post-weld heat treatment may be needed based on thickness and service conditions.
- Tolerances are per ASTM A6/A6M unless otherwise agreed.
